You cannot install a 64-bit version of OneNote if you already have 32-bit versions of other Office applications (like Excel or Word) installed on your system. You must match the architecture of existing Office components.

Microsoft does not offer a simple "OneNote.exe" file on their website. To get a true offline installer for OneNote, you have to use the . This is Microsoft’s official channel for IT professionals.
